Robot Arm
Embedded Rust adventure controlling an EEZYbotARM with the Embassy framework. Learning electronics, real-time systems, and the joy of hardware debugging.
I write code and maintain a complicated relationship with simplicity. When not wrestling with embedded systems or AI experiments, you’ll find me collecting hobbies and curating curiosities. This documentation showcases my journey through modern development practices, from bare-metal programming to AI-assisted workflows.
Robot Arm
Embedded Rust adventure controlling an EEZYbotARM with the Embassy framework. Learning electronics, real-time systems, and the joy of hardware debugging.
Fretsome
A decidedly nerdy music practice tool with multiple interfaces (CLI, web, mobile). Built with modern Rust frameworks to explore cross-platform development.
Template Processor
A Rust CLI application for template processing, developed as a case study in AI-assisted development workflows.
Habit Tracker
Practical productivity tool that generates printable habit tracking sheets. Features CI/CD pipelines and explores the intersection of code and personal development.
Learning Through Building
Every project is an excuse to explore new technologies and deepen understanding. Sometimes the journey matters more than the destination.
AI-Enhanced Workflows
Leveraging AI for rapid prototyping, pattern recognition, and documentation generation while maintaining human oversight and deep technical understanding.
Cross-Platform Curiosity
Building applications that work across different platforms and interfaces, from embedded systems to web applications.
Documentation as Craft
Treating documentation as a creative endeavor that enhances understanding and enables collaboration.
Codeberg Profile
View all my repositories and ongoing projects on Codeberg.
Development Environment
Explore my dotfiles and development setup philosophy.
Project Documentation
Detailed guides for setting up and understanding each project.